What are some effective activities to train students’ Sun facts comprehension skill when teaching them about Space?

Effective activities for training students' comprehension of Sun facts include interactive quizzes, creating solar system models with emphasis on the Sun, engaging in solar observation projects using safe methods, crafting and presenting research projects on the Sun, and conducting experiments that simulate solar phenomena (like solar flares or sunspots). These hands-on experiences enhance learning and retention.

How to test a Grade 3 student’s Sun facts comprehension skills?

To test a Grade 3 student's comprehension of Sun facts, employ a mix of multiple-choice questions, true/false statements, and short-answer questions covering basic concepts such as the Sun's position in the solar system, its importance to Earth, characteristics (e. g. , its being a star), and simple effects on Earth (like day and night or seasons).
